# Webhook retry budget for the Cormorant delivery service.
# New folks: deliveries are retried with exponential backoff starting
# at 30 seconds, doubling up to a 6-hour ceiling, for at most this many
# attempts. After the budget is exhausted the event is parked in the
# dead-letter store, not dropped — consumers can replay from there.
# Retries are only triggered on 5xx or timeouts; 4xx responses fail
# fast by design. This policy was locked in with the build identified
# by the token below.

build token for yajof-bajof: htk31_506ff1188f74596b5bb2eec94edc43c

Picking this up from the previous maintainer: the Orchalet thumbnail queue accepts jobs from external plugins via the standard submit API. Key facts for plugin authors: jobs over 40MB get routed to the slow lane, priority flags are honored only for verified plugins, and failed renders retry three times before landing in the dead-letter bucket, which plugins can poll. Source images must include format metadata or they're rejected at intake. Rate limits, payload schemas, and the retry policy are documented here.

dashboard of bafof-hafog = https://confluence.lumiclabs.internal/display/browse/display/6a09a20a

Leadership Review Briefing — Gross Margin

Quick heads-up before Thursday's session: margins on the Fernway line slipped about two points this quarter, mostly freight and a one-off rework charge at the Dalbrook plant. Tollis and Wexcomb lines are holding steady. We'll walk through the bridge chart and the corrective actions Priya's team has scoped — nothing alarming, but the board will ask. Keep the deck to six slides. There's one sensitive point to flag first.

management briefing: Project Ulavan slips by two quarters because of the staffing delay.

// Retry ceiling for the Parcelwick webhook dispatcher. Carriers on the
// Nordvale lane batch status events, so anything above 6 retries just
// hammers their gateway and triggers throttling. Do not raise this for
// the holiday freeze; ops at Brimhall signed off on 6. If deliveries
// stall, check the dead-letter queue before touching this value.
// Release builds must pin the dispatcher image to the token below.
// The current pinned token follows.

build token for kagaf-hahof: htk14_9d3d4d26d7d8de